我国是煤炭资源生产大国,利用清洁煤技术,改变传统煤炭消费方式,是我国工业领域目前迫切需要解决的工作之一.清洁煤制气是煤炭高效清洁利用的重要技术之一.某生产企业一期工程采用2×260 t/h高温高压循环流化床锅炉、1×60 000 Nm³/h褐煤制清洁煤气的循环流化床煤气化炉,作为生产工艺用能来源.单台煤气炉年煤耗量 22 万吨,产生的固体颗粒废弃物飞灰年总量达 3 万吨.实现煤气炉飞灰替代燃料,可以节省大量燃料成本,并对高效利用煤制气飞灰变废为宝、节能减排提供高效高经济性的优化选项.

China is a major producer of coal resources.To adopt clean coal technology and change the traditional way of coal consumption is one of the urgent tasks in China's industrial field.Clean coal-to-gas is one of the important technologies for efficient and clean utilization of coal.The first phase project of a certain producer adopts 2×260t/h high temperature and high pressure circulating fluidized bed boilers and 1×60,000 Nm³/h lignite-to-clean gas circulating fluidized bed gasifier as the energy source for production process.The annual coal consumption of a single gasifier is 220,000 tons,and the total amount of solid particle waste fly ash generated reaches 30,000 tons.Realizing the substitution of fly ash from gasifier for fuel can save a lot of fuel costs,and provide an efficient and economical optimization option for the efficient utilization of fly ash from coal gasification,turning waste into treasure,and energy conservation and emission reduction.
